Default Kayaking Long Beach Thursday evening



Andy Darrin and I headed from Sunset to Long Beach a little after 6 the wind was blowing when we left. While we unloaded at Claremont the wind died and our excitement of finally making an evening trip to the wall rose. As we paddled out to Chaffee Island the wind started up so we fished the north kind of protected side of the Island. Ron joined us shortly later and Aaron and Clay stopped by in Clay’s skiff to say hi. We dodged crew boats and a tug and barge to pick on the calico and sand bass and a barracuda. My bass came from in tight and behind the Crew Boat dock losing a number to the rocks and pilings all on the Fluke covered in Uni Butter. We headed in about 10:30. I have been trying out the Eagle 350 so on the way in I brought up the track pointed the arrow at the point of origin on the beach and followed it in. After landing started rolling the kayak up toward the turnaround and found I was in the tracks from our roll to the water very impressive. Great evening with a great group :gone: :gone: :gone:
